Context: The Same Address, Two Years Apart
Scam Sniffer flagged the event early on [Date - assume recent]. The victim's addresses — long tracked by on-chain sleuths — were suddenly empty. The 2023 attack was a classic phishing trap: the victim signed a malicious "increase allowance" transaction, giving the attacker control over stETH and rETH. That time, the attacker returned 90% of the funds after pressure. Maybe that created a false sense of security.
This time, the attack vector is different: private key compromise. That's not a contract bug. It's not a clever DeFi exploit. It's a failure in the most basic layer of crypto security — key management. The attacker moved with surgical precision: two wallets cleaned in 15 minutes, then a rapid swap through DEXs into DAI and ETH, followed by dispersion across multiple addresses. No waiting for signatures. No social engineering. Just pure, unfiltered access.
Core: What the On-Chain Data Tells Us
Let's break down the technicals. The victim's portfolio included DAI, WBTC, aUSDC, LDO, sUSDe, and ETH — a mix of stablecoins, wrapped Bitcoin, governance tokens, and yield-bearing assets. This isn't a casual trader. This is a deep DeFi participant, likely holding leveraged positions (the aUSDC signals an Aave deposit).
The attacker's behavior reveals a professional operation. Within 15 minutes, both wallets were drained. Within an hour, the assets were swapped to DAI and ETH. The choice of DAI over USDC or USDT is telling: DAI and ETH offer better privacy for on-chain laundering through mixers like Tornado Cash or cross-chain bridges. The attacker also avoided large, trackable transfers to centralized exchanges initially — instead, they fragmented the funds into smaller chunks, likely to avoid triggering automated alarms.
Based on my experience auditing security incidents, the speed and coordination here suggest automated bots and real-time monitoring. The attacker had a pre-configured script that detected the wallet's activity and executed the swaps. This isn't a manual job. It's a well-oiled machine.
But here's the critical insight: the victim's private keys were likely exposed long before the attack. The attacker didn't just find the keys today. They were sitting on them, waiting for the right moment. The fact that the victim was hit by phishing in 2023 and then by a key leak in 2024/25 suggests a pattern of security negligence. Either the same attacker maintained persistent access, or the victim's operational security never improved.

Contrarian Angle: The Real Story Isn't the Hack — It's the Narrative Trap
Everyone will focus on the $25M loss. But the real story is the dangerous narrative that's being reinforced: "Self-custody is too risky; better to trust a centralized exchange."
I call bullshit.
This isn't a failure of self-custody. It's a failure of bad security habits. The victim stored private keys in a vulnerable environment — likely a cloud backup, a screenshot, or a browser extension that was compromised. The solution isn't to hand your coins to a custodial third party. It's to use hardware wallets, multi-sig, or MPC wallets. The industry has known this for years. Yet we keep seeing the same mistakes.
The contrarian take: this event will actually accelerate the adoption of smart contract wallets and account abstraction (ERC-4337). The market is already pricing in a shift toward social recovery and multi-factor authentication for on-chain assets. Projects like Safe (formerly Gnosis Safe) and Web3Auth are gaining traction. Takeaway: What to Watch Next
The attacker's next move will determine the fate of these funds. If they flow into a mixer like Tornado Cash, the trail goes cold. If they hit a centralized exchange, there's a chance of freezing. But given the attacker's professionalism, I expect the funds to be laundered through a cross-chain bridge and then into a privacy coin.
For the rest of us: stop using hot wallets for large amounts. Stop storing seed phrases in email drafts. Use a hardware wallet. Use a multi-sig. If you don't, you're not a crypto native — you're a target.
